Using Rack Systems for Dumerils

pathigdon Jan 05, 2009 08:28 PM

Is anyone using a rack system for ADULT Dums? If so, please post some pics. I am trying to get some ideas.

I have seen tubs that would work, but haven't seen any in use. IRIS & Sterilite both make large tubs. IRIS makes a tub that measures 53"Lx21"Wx14"T and Sterilite's tub measures 44"Lx20"Wx6.5"T. Which would you use if were building a rack. Also, would you use back heat or belly heat.

Don't have any pics, but I have bred Dumerils in rack systems. It depends on the Dumerils you're working with though. I have some, and have seen many that would require a pretty large rack/tub size. I have one female in particular though that successfully bred and produced in a 28qt. rack.

PBM Jan 10, 2009 01:09 AM

Sorry, didn't answer any questions in there did I. Alright, from my animals, I think 14" would be a bit of wasted height. I kept Dumerils in a rack I made that had tubs that were around 15" and it was just wasted space. Those racks are long gone! I would choose belly heat over back heat, but I think that is just personal preference.

My breeder females are 7ft & 5ft and my breeder male is 6ft. I have one more female that will be ready breed next season and she is about 4ft. She cycled this season, but I didn't breed her because of her size & age (she's a small '05). The only thing that worries me about the shorter tub is that it is really short (6 1/2 inches). the length and width are great though. I agree that the other tub is a bit tall, but I cannot find an in-between hieght tub.
